Research On Packet Loss Characteristics In VANETs

In recent years,research on VANET has extensive prospect due to the merging of wireless communication and transmission technique.The vehicle network is a mobile self-organizing network in the actual traffic environment.In VANET,nodes establish networks and implement routing and delivery of data packets through mutual cooperation.However,due to the rapid change of the network topology,frequent communication link switching,short link duration,and rapid changes in surrounding complex environments,the wireless channel is subject to constant external interference,resulting in a more unstable vehicle network environment.The high-speed mobility of the vehicle and other factors make the vehicle self-organizing network have many complex features,which brings challenges to the transmission mechanism,which affects the performance of the vehicle self-organizing network,resulting in a high packet loss rate in the vehicle self-organizing network.These mean that the tuning of the performance of the vehicle network is very research-oriented.This paper analyzes and optimizes the packet loss performance of the vehicle network.Since deploying vehicles in real traffic scenarios is costly and difficult,using network simulation is a viable alternative when studying the performance of in-vehicle networks.This paper combines the traffic flow simulator to provide vehicle simulation scenarios and network simulators to provide performance analysis of network communication performance simulation experiments.First of all,the experiment considers many factors,through a series of simulation experiments on different influencing factors such as vehicle density,vehicle speed change,and number of lanes,and obtains packet loss data for comparative analysis.Secondly,we the analyzed cause of packet loss according to the performance of the IEEE802.11 p protocol under intensive traffic conditions.Then,we modified the AODV protocol by modifying the routing protocol source code to improve the packet loss performance of the vehicle self-organizing network.Finally,compare and analyze the packet loss characteristics before and after optimization,and verify the effectiveness of the improved routing protocol in the optimization of packet loss performance of vehicle self-organizing network.In this paper,the packet loss characteristics of vehicle self-organizing network are analyzed.The analysis results show that the vehicle density affects the packet loss rate and throughput of the vehicle network.The packet loss rate fluctuates with the increase of vehicle density,and the vehicle speed limit range has no obvious impact on the packet loss rate.Meanwhile,considering the packet loss characteristics of the vehicle network,the ant colony algorithm is added to the AODV protocol for optimization and improvement.Under the same traffic simulation scenario,the packet loss rate of the improved new-AODV protocol is lower than that of the AODV protocol,and the network has better stability.
